  1. BMI = Body Mass Index; PTB = Preterm Birth.
  2. aData from 189 mothers with early medically-induced PTBs, 277 mothers with late medically-induced PTBs, 320 mothers with early spontaneous PTBs, 610 mothers with late spontaneous PTBs, and 3281 mothers with term births.
  3. bMultinomial regression used to compare early and late medically-induced and spontaneous PTB with term birth (reference group).
  4. cAdjusted model includes maternal age, race/ethnicity, marital status, income, education, child sex, maternal gestational weight gain, smoking, alcohol or illicit drug use, stress, parity, cervical incompetence, and placenta previa.
  5. dHypertensive disorders of pregnancy are categorized as chronic hypertension, mild preeclampsia, severe hypertensive disorders (severe preeclampsia, eclampsia, HELLP syndrome), and none.
  6. eChorioamnionitis is categorized as subclinical chorioamnionitis, clinical chorioamnionitis, and none.
  7. fMaternal diabetes is categorized as gestational diabetes or diabetes prior to pregnancy vs. none.
